7 POUNDS OF PRESSURE Release New Track ‘Birds Of Prey’

Rock band 7 POUNDS OF PRESSURE have released their debut single titled “Birds of Prey” to all digital outlets. The single was mixed by Eric Rachel (Skid Row, Symphony X) and mastered by Alan Douches (Skid Row, Symphony X). The band will release their debut, full length album later this year. The music is a mix of metal, rock, classic rock, and a hint of progressive rock. The band’s influences are a combination of Judas Priest, Pantera, Metallica and Symphony X.

Says Steve Tobin when asked about the new album’s theme: “The military theme aspect is about my dad’s military experiences. My dad was an Army Paratrooper, an Airborne Ranger in the Korean war out of the 82nd, although the songs can apply to all military personnel and all people’s personal experiences. It Isn’t pro war. It’s merely sharing some experiences.
